Description

A vulnerability was identified in MapQuest Get Directions App 10.16.1 on Android. This vulnerability affects the function getDataColumn of the file ExpoShareIntentModule.kt of the component com.mapquest.android.ace. The manipulation leads to path traversal. An attack has to be approached locally. The exploit is publicly available and might be used.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
